출시 HN: Adam (YC W25) – 오픈소스 AI CAD

발행: (2026년 6월 18일 AM 01:14 GMT+9)
5 분 소요

출처: 해커 뉴스

안녕하세요, Hacker News 커뮤니티 여러분! 저는 Adam에서 온 Zach입니다 (https://adam.new/). 우리는 기계식 CAD 소프트웨어용 AI 에이전트를 개발하고 있습니다. 우린 이 회사를 두 가지 기본적인 신념에 기반해 만들었습니다:

  • AI는 소프트웨어와 마찬가지로 기계 설계의 주요 매개체가 될 것입니다.
  • CAD 생성에 가장 적합한 패러다임은 텍스트를 코드로 변환하고, 그 코드를 CAD으로 생성하는 방식(텍스트 → 코드 → CAD)입니다.

우리는 오픈 소스 텍스트에서 CAD로 변환하는 플랫폼인 CADAM을 개발하고 있습니다. 이는 인증, 데이터베이스, 파일 저장을 위한 Supabase 백엔크를 갖춘 React 앱(TanStack Start)입니다. TinkerCAD와 비슷하다고 생각하세요. Demo: https://www.youtube.com/watch?v=iESOr7EGWqk Try it: https://adam.new/cadam/

작동합니다:

  • 자연어에서 파라메트릭 3D 모델을 생성하며, 텍스트 프롬프트와 이미지 참조 모두 지원합니다.
  • OpenSCAD 코드를 출력하고, 자동으로 추출된 파라미터를 슬라이더 형태로 표시해 즉시 치수 조정이 가능하도록 합니다.
  • .STL 또는 .SCAD 파일(.OBJ, GLB/GLTF, FBX, DXF 포함)로 내보냅니다.

안에 속속:

  • 시스템 프롬프트와 도구를 교체하는 두 모드(에이전트 엔드포인트)를 갖춘 하나의 에이전시 엔드포인트: 파라메트릭 모드는 build_parametric_model 툴을 통해 OpenSCAD를 작성/편집하고, 메쉬 모드는 3D 텍스처 메시를 생성합니다.
  • 간단한 파라미터 조작은 모델을 완전히 우회합니다; 슬라이더를 조정하면 SCAD 소스에 대한 결정적 정규식 업데이트가 이루어져 LLM 호출이 필요 없습니다.
  • Vercel AI SDK를 통해 모델 무관하게 구현됩니다: Anthropic (Claude), Google (Gemini), OpenAI 및 기타 모델은 OpenRouter을 통해 사용 가능하며, 최신 모델에서는 적응형 사고가 자동으로 활성화됩니다. 우리 평가에 따르면 Gemini 3.1 Pro가 최고 모델입니다.
  • 브라우저 내에서 완전히 실행되며, OpenSCAD를 WebAssembly(웹 워커에서 실행되어 UI가 차단되지 않음)로 컴파일하고, Three.js를 React Three Fiber를 통해 렌더링합니다.
  • BOSL, BOSL2, MCAD 라이브러리를 지원하고, 모델 내 텍스트에는 Geist 폰트를 사용할 수 있습니다.

미래 개선:

  • build123d와 CadQuery를 모두 지원하여 CSG 프라임스를 넘어 제약 기반 모델링으로 확장하고, 다른 코드-어- CAD 프라임트와의 직접적인 비교를 제공합니다.
  • 공간 인식 향상: face/엣지 선택 UI와 뷰포트 이미지 통합을 통해 LLMs에 공간 이해를 제공합니다.

레포지토리를 복제하고 로컬에서 실행할 수 있습니다! 기여는 매우 환영됩니다. 댓글 URL: https://news.ycombinator.com/item?id=48572553 점수: 63

댓글: 23

0 조회
Back to Blog

관련 글

더 보기 »

하라주쿠의 순간

!https://lh7-us.googleusercontent.com/BtsLQo0Q5aOwbYqqQ2qG8gOWAx-UB65p4aMp_UsJ1yKBDX7RdafkwVh7ryfjOLnaSO5595YB8zw0JRPgFINzJortBlCJhigXLawaDFy8AMXFYRSy-TLQRJGHqB...